Trishan Esram is a scholar working on Renewable Energy, Sustainability and the Environment, Electrical and Electronic Engineering and Artificial Intelligence. According to data from OpenAlex, Trishan Esram has authored 3 papers receiving a total of 2.8k indexed citations (citations by other indexed papers that have themselves been cited), including 3 papers in Renewable Energy, Sustainability and the Environment, 2 papers in Electrical and Electronic Engineering and 1 paper in Artificial Intelligence. Recurrent topics in Trishan Esram’s work include Photovoltaic System Optimization Techniques (3 papers), solar cell performance optimization (2 papers) and Solar Thermal and Photovoltaic Systems (1 paper). Trishan Esram is often cited by papers focused on Photovoltaic System Optimization Techniques (3 papers), solar cell performance optimization (2 papers) and Solar Thermal and Photovoltaic Systems (1 paper). Trishan Esram collaborates with scholars based in United States. Trishan Esram's co-authors include Patrick L. Chapman, Jonathan W. Kimball, P. Midya and Philip T. Krein and has published in prestigious journals such as IEEE Transactions on Power Electronics, Renewable Energy and IEEE Transactions on Energy Conversion.
